Derek Cook, founder of DDC Law, is a prominent West Texas trial lawyer specializing in litigation and appellate advocacy across Midland, Odessa, and the Permian Basin. Known for his tenacity and fearless courtroom presence, he excels in commercial litigation, business disputes, and a broad spectrum of legal areas including oil and gas litigation, civil appeals, and family law. Derek's deep Texas roots began in Wichita Falls, where his passion for law was cultivated. He graduated with a History degree from UT-Arlington and a J.D. from Baylor Law School, refining his skills in the esteemed Practice Court program.
Beginning his career at a midsize Midland firm, Derek tackled complex legal issues, building a vast repertoire of successful trial experience, such as securing a $1.9 million jury verdict against a major corporation. His client-centric approach and ethical standards make him a sought-after attorney in West Texas. In addition to his legal practice, Derek contributes to the community through leadership roles in the Midland County Bar Association and advocacy for mental health awareness, often sharing his own recovery journey. A respected speaker and writer, his work appears in numerous legal publications, including Texas Lawyer Magazine and The Texas Bar Journal.

Hourly rates, contingency fees, and flat-fee options
Every business matter is priced differently. Simple document review might be a flat fee. Injury litigation is often contingency. Complex commercial disputes usually run hourly with a retainer. Derek confirms the model in the engagement letter before any work starts.
